A Grammatical Dictionary of Botanical Latin

 
abbreviatus,-a,-um (part.A): shortened, cut back; see broken, interrupted; abbreviated [> L. abbrevio,-are: “to shorten, abridge” (Lewis & Short); cf. brevis,-e (adj.B), q.v., short; curtus,-a,-um (adj.A), q.v., short; opp. elongatus,-a,-um (adj.A), lengthened;

abbreviatus, ‘shortened,’ may be used e.g.:

1.‘for the overall size (Senecio; Asteraceae) 2. for the small plants, with few leaves and flowers (Phyllobolus; Aizoaceae) 3. for the very short internodes of the lateral branches (Mitrophyllum; Aizoaceae) 4. for the reduced leaf lamina (Ruschia; Aizoaceae)) 5. for the short corolla tips (Ceropegia arabica var.; Apocynaceae).

- planta heterostyla, androdynamica a gynodynamica nisi stylo abbreviato et filamentis exsertis vix diversa, plant heterostylous, the androdynamous one from the gynodynamous except for the abbreviated style and exserted filaments scarcely different (Stearn).

- racemuli v. glomeruli axillares terminalesque abbreviati (B&H), shortened small racemes or heads axillary and terminal.

- laciniae e basi versus apicem decrescentes vel infimae paullulum abbreviatae, the laciniae from the base to the apex diminishing or the lowest ones a little abbreviated (Stearn).

- [Eulychnis] anthophorum longum aut in quibusdam subabbreviatum (DeCandolle), the anthorphoe long or in certain [sc. species] slightly shortened.

- [Calycanthus] sepala v. petala oo-serialia, ab extimis paucis bracteaeformibus, in interiora oo, petaloidea, gradatim abeuntia, intima abbreviata (B&H), sepals or petals [indefinite]- seriate, from the outermost few that are bractiform [i.e. bract-shaped], into the inner, that are indefinite, petal-like, gradually changing, the innermost shortened.

- stamina subdefinita (12-21), abbreviato-cuneata, carnosa (B&H), the stamens nearly definite (12-21), shortened-cuneate, fleshy.

- flores extus sericei, cymosi, cymis nunc abbreviatis dense congestis, nunc laxius multifloris pedunculatis (B&H), the flowers outside silky, cymose, with the cymes sometimes shortened, densely congested, sometimes more lax, many-flowered, pedunculate.

- ovarium 1, nunc abbreviatum, nunc elongatum (DeCandolle), ovary 1, sometimes shortened, sometimes elongate.

- [Cruciferae] fructus siliquatus, nunc elongatus et tunc siliqua dicitur, nunc abbreviatus et tunc silicula, rarius 1-locularis evalvis, saepius bilocularis bivalvis (DeCandolle), the fruit siliquate [i.e. somewhat like a siliqua], sometimes elongate and then it is called a siliqua, sometimes shortened and then called a silicle, rather rarely 1-locular, without valves, more often bilocular with two valves.

- [Nasturtium] siliqua teretiuscula, abbreviata aut declinata (DeCandolle), the siliqua somewhat terete [i.e. rounded and cylindric], shortened or DECLINATE (bent or curved downwards or forwards).

Microsphaera abbreviata, in allusion to the very short appendages.

Alyssum canescens var. abbreviatum: racemo brevi corymboso (DeCandolle), with the raceme short, corymbose.
